dpkg-buildpackage -rfakeroot -D -us -uc dpkg-buildpackage: source package moodle dpkg-buildpackage: source version 2.7.16+dfsg-1~bpo8+1 dpkg-buildpackage: source distribution jessie-backports dpkg-buildpackage: source changed by Joost van Baal-Ilić dpkg-source --before-build moodle-2.7.16+dfsg dpkg-buildpackage: host architecture amd64 fakeroot debian/rules clean dh clean dh_testdir dh_auto_clean dh_clean dpkg-source -b moodle-2.7.16+dfsg dpkg-source: info: using source format `3.0 (quilt)' dpkg-source: info: building moodle using existing ./moodle_2.7.16+dfsg.orig.tar.xz dpkg-source: info: building moodle in moodle_2.7.16+dfsg-1~bpo8+1.debian.tar.xz dpkg-source: info: building moodle in moodle_2.7.16+dfsg-1~bpo8+1.dsc debian/rules build dh build dh_testdir dh_auto_configure dh_auto_build dh_auto_test fakeroot debian/rules binary dh binary dh_testroot dh_prep dh_installdirs dh_auto_install dh_install dh_installdocs dh_installchangelogs dh_installcron dh_installdebconf debian/rules override_dh_lintian make[1]: Entering directory '/home/joostvb/local/src/debian/moodle/moodle-2.7.16+dfsg' # remove unnecessary license and copyright files rm debian/moodle/usr/share/moodle/lib/bennu/COPYRIGHT.txt rm debian/moodle/usr/share/moodle/lib/bennu/LICENSE.txt rm debian/moodle/usr/share/moodle/lib/dragmath/COPYRIGHT.html rm debian/moodle/usr/share/moodle/lib/phpmailer/LICENSE rm debian/moodle/usr/share/moodle/lib/pear/HTTP/WebDAV/COPYING rm debian/moodle/usr/share/moodle/lib/pear/HTTP/WebDAV/LICENSE rm debian/moodle/usr/share/moodle/lib/minify/LICENSE.txt rm debian/moodle/usr/share/moodle/lib/tcpdf/LICENSE.TXT rm debian/moodle/usr/share/moodle/lib/xhprof/LICENSE rm debian/moodle/usr/share/moodle/lib/editor/tinymce/tiny_mce/3.5.10/license.txt rm debian/moodle/usr/share/moodle/lib/editor/atto/yui/src/rangy/js/license.txt rm debian/moodle/usr/share/moodle/lib/tcpdf/fonts/freefont-20120503/COPYING rm debian/moodle/usr/share/moodle/lib/yui/license.txt rm debian/moodle/usr/share/moodle/lib/google/LICENSE rm debian/moodle/usr/share/moodle/lib/jquery/MIT-LICENSE.txt rm debian/moodle/usr/share/moodle/lib/markdown/License.md rm debian/moodle/usr/share/moodle/pix/f/FileTypesIcons-LICENSE.txt rm debian/moodle/usr/share/moodle/pix/f/Oxygen-LICENSE.txt # remove unnecessary files rm debian/moodle/usr/share/moodle/mod/chat/chatd.php # remove more unnecessary files (still found in moodle-2.7.15) find debian/moodle -type f -name .cvsignore -delete # remove files with missing source rm debian/moodle/usr/share/moodle/filter/tex/*mimetex* rm debian/moodle/usr/share/moodle/lib/flowplayer/* rmdir debian/moodle/usr/share/moodle/lib/flowplayer # fix permissions find debian/moodle/usr -type f -exec chmod 644 {} \; find debian/moodle/usr -type d -exec chmod 755 {} \; chmod 755 debian/moodle/usr/share/moodle/admin/mailout-debugger.php chmod 755 debian/moodle/usr/share/moodle/filter/algebra/algebra2tex.pl chmod 755 debian/moodle/usr/share/moodle/admin/process_email.php # remove libraries which depend upon non-free stuff cd debian/moodle/usr/share/moodle/lib && rm -r phpexcel # un-bundle libraries (symlinks created later via debian/links) rm debian/moodle/usr/share/moodle/lib/phpmailer/class.{phpmailer,smtp}.php rm -r debian/moodle/usr/share/moodle/lib/adodb rm -r debian/moodle/usr/share/moodle/lib/htmlpurifier/{HTMLPurifier,HTMLPurifier.php,HTMLPurifier.safe-includes.php} rm -r debian/moodle/usr/share/moodle/lib/tcpdf rm -r debian/moodle/usr/share/moodle/auth/cas/CAS/{CAS.php,CAS} rm debian/moodle/usr/share/moodle/lib/jquery/jquery-migrate-1.2.1.{,min.}js # set dir permissions chown www-data:www-data debian/moodle/var/lib/moodle chmod 0750 debian/moodle/var/lib/moodle dh_lintian make[1]: Leaving directory '/home/joostvb/local/src/debian/moodle/moodle-2.7.16+dfsg' dh_perl dh_link dh_compress dh_fixperms dh_installdeb dh_gencontrol dpkg-gencontrol: warning: package moodle: unused substitution variable ${perl:Depends} dh_md5sums debian/rules override_dh_builddeb make[1]: Entering directory '/home/joostvb/local/src/debian/moodle/moodle-2.7.16+dfsg' dh_builddeb dpkg-deb: building package `moodle' in `../moodle_2.7.16+dfsg-1~bpo8+1_all.deb'. make[1]: Leaving directory '/home/joostvb/local/src/debian/moodle/moodle-2.7.16+dfsg' dpkg-genchanges >../moodle_2.7.16+dfsg-1~bpo8+1_amd64.changes dpkg-genchanges: not including original source code in upload dpkg-source --after-build moodle-2.7.16+dfsg dpkg-buildpackage: binary and diff upload (original source NOT included) Now running lintian... E: moodle changes: backports-changes-missing E: moodle source: source-is-missing lib/yuilib/3.15.0/text-data-wordbreak/text-data-wordbreak-debug.js E: moodle source: source-is-missing lib/yuilib/3.15.0/datatable-paginator/lang/datatable-paginator_fr.js E: moodle source: source-is-missing lib/yuilib/3.15.0/autocomplete-list/lang/autocomplete-list_hu.js E: moodle source: source-is-missing lib/yuilib/2in3/2.9.0/build/yui2-yuiloader-dom-event/yui2-yuiloader-dom-event-debug.js E: moodle source: source-is-missing lib/yuilib/2in3/2.9.0/build/yui2-yahoo-dom-event/yui2-yahoo-dom-event-debug.js E: moodle source: source-is-missing lib/yuilib/2in3/2.9.0/build/yui2-utilities/yui2-utilities-debug.js W: moodle source: newer-standards-version 3.9.8 (current is 3.9.6) N: 151 tags overridden (145 errors, 6 warnings) Finished running lintian. Now signing changes and any dsc files... signfile moodle_2.7.16+dfsg-1~bpo8+1.dsc 0x0B86B067 signfile moodle_2.7.16+dfsg-1~bpo8+1_amd64.changes 0x0B86B067 Successfully signed dsc and changes files